Family Trip to Alicante for a Month — Looking for Kid-Friendly Local Suggestions (Ages 3 & 2) by Far-Passage6677 in Alicante

[–]HomeCosta 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Spain is very child friendly. Places to visit i would include the little theme park in Alicante. Its called El mundo de los ninos. https://youtu.be/QmSohle5hLg?si=r-WlL83JljsHgP52

Benidorm has one aswell but i would avoid that one, way to busy.

If u look for a quiet beach look into playa el pinet in la marina. Its very quiet compared to other places. The beach is great for children because its less crowded. On a good day the water is calm enough for toddlers https://youtu.be/Z4SpV7f0G70?si=p_5Dhm5PScrKKRJ1

Santa Pola has nice beaches aswell and the water is very calm. U have Pola Park a small themepark there. https://youtu.be/Rri6WkbiQwk?si=YRLh5_SU1OIZ5p6G

In La Zenia u have a shopping boulevard where u can rent drivable remote control cars https://youtube.com/shorts/3dwKrFzSCqg?feature=share

In Elche is a zoo https://youtu.be/xQRwwYo656g?feature=shared
